Storyline
Josh was a promising basketball player until a knee injury cut his career short. Now he spends his days on half-hearted rap attempts and whatever get-rich-quick scheme his best friend Kunle brings up. His sister Ronke and her boyfriend Uncle K worry about him, and they believe he still has potential. When Ronke leaves town for three days, Josh is left with Uncle K, who offers encouragement and a chance to help with an upcoming product launch. Kunle tries to pull Josh into a streaming venture, insisting that shouting W's in the chat is the key to wealth, but Josh is not impressed. A job interview goes badly, and Josh feels the failure confirm what he already thinks of himself. Uncle K introduces Josh to Zanele, a confident influencer hired to promote a skincare line. Their first encounter is tense, and Zanele dismisses Josh as jobless. Later that evening they meet at a lounge, where the tension shifts into attraction and they share a kiss. Uncle K catches them and gives Josh a week to make Zanele his girlfriend, or he will tell Ronke. Josh pursues Zanele, but she begins to pull back and insists their intimacy is just sex, that he is moving too fast. Following his sister's advice, Josh decides to find out what Zanele truly wants. When he arrives at her house, a man at the gate insists she has traveled and warns him against her. Heartbroken, Josh collapses in despair and later sits alone on a basketball court. Zanele finds him there and reveals she never left. She had only wanted Josh to find his own way instead of clinging to her as a substitute for his lost career. They reconcile, and Zanele reassures him that he will play basketball again. With her support, Josh steps back onto the court. He plays with renewed energy, and when he dunks the ball, the crowd erupts and chants his old nickname, Mamba. His family and friends cheer him on.
